Important notice: This page contains lore relevant to the … 2021-3-2 · "Now that the dust has settled on last month?s civil unrest in Burma, it is worth pausing to reflect on the protests and official responses to see if any important factors have escaped public attention. 2021-3-1 2021-4-8 · Burma experienced major political unrest in 1988 when the military regime jailed as well as killed thousands of Burmese democracy activists. In 1990, the military government refused to recognize the results of an election that the opposition won overwhelmingly. Major demonstrations by opposition activists occurred in 1996 and 1998. BACKGROUND Ethnic conflict in Burma has continued through every political era since independence in 1948. In the process, countless lives have been lost, millions of citizens displaced and the country declined to become one of Asia’s poorest.
